NASCAR officials set the stage for a stock-car race on Chicago's city streets with the development of a pixelated version of a street circuit for the eNASCAR iRacing Pro Invitational Series. With real-life NASCAR racing set to debut on a downtown Chicago street course next season, take in all the scenes from last year's iRacing event on the virtual version.

The Buckingham Fountain, a Chicago landmark, sits in the foreground of Grant Park, where the circuit will take a winding path around to complete the 2.2-mile lap.

Austin Dillon's No. 3 Chevrolet makes the 90-degree right-hander for Turn 12 onto the home straightaway. In non-racing conditions, that's a right turn from East Jackson Drive onto South Columbus.
